Ability to set default image quality for Capture mode of Box mobile app
With Capture mode of Box mobile app, the default value for quality is "Original", in which case the images are taken with HEIC format. This is not optimal for Windows users (as HEIC is not supported), and the workaround is to use "High" or lower quality (in which case images are saved in jpg) but each user needs to manually configure this for his/her own device. We want the ability to configure this globally from admin console.

Update m.box.com address for shared link previews on smartphones
Please change the specification so that it does not change to the m.box.com address when previewing the shared link from smartphone.
<Background>
・We want to share the preview screen easily to many unspecified users.
・But there are some shared links that can't be previewed on smartphone.
・The target shared link can be previewed successfully from the PC.
・The reason is that when you access the shared link from smartphone, the address is always changed to m.box.com.
・You can get around this problem by getting a free Box account (Individual) and installing Box for Mobile.

Box Mobile - GPS coordinates and Date Taken
Box Mobile – GPS coordinates metadata location. In Box capture, capture saves location metadata about the photo, the longitude and latitude coordinates as Box metadata. The Box Mobile app photo does not save location as metadata on Box but instead you have to access the File Information to get the longitude and latitude of the photo. This is a request to update the Box Mobile to save the location coordinates (metadata) as metadata in Box in addition to file information.
Also, Box app doesn’t capture the metadata for “Date Taken”
